刚开始使用laravel并发现它非常酷的框架,我使用基本的购物车,在我添加到购物车选项后,产品值转到另一个名为" customer_items&#的表34;以及当前用户ID
现在,当我想调用当前已添加到购物车并将其显示在表格中的产品时, 这是代码
{{1}}
注意:{{$ items-> product_price}},通常会有4个项目由用户添加, 我想从每一行获得产品价格的总价值,
先谢谢你的帮助:)!
答案 0 :(得分:1)
使用它并且工作正常,
<?php $total = 0; ?>
@foreach($shoppingCarts as $items)
<?php $total += $items->product_price; ?>
<tr>
<td class="name"><a href="#">{{ $items->product_name }}</a></td>
<td class="price">{{ $items->product_price }}</td>
<td class="total">{{ $total }}<a href="#"><img class="tooltip-test" data-original-title="Remove" src="img/remove.png" alt=""></a></td>
</tr>
@endforeach
或
@foreach($shoppingCarts as $items)
<tr>
<td class="name"><a href="#">{{ $items->product_name }}</a></td>
<td class="price">{{ $items->product_price }}</td>
<td class="total">{{ $items->sum('product_price') }}<a href="#"><img class="tooltip-test" data-original-title="Remove" src="img/remove.png" alt=""></a></td>
</tr>
@endforeach
感谢大家的支持:)!
来源:https://laracasts.com/discuss/channels/general-discussion/get-total-value-from-table-rows